About

Dubai Harbour - Bay Marina is mainly about seeing Dubai from the water. It suits travelers who want a clearer sense of the city’s waterfront layout. A guided boat tour frames the skyline, marina basins and coastal developments in one continuous view. This is not a landmark-heavy visit in the usual sense. Its value lies in perspective. From the boat, it becomes easier to understand how Dubai Marina, Palm Jumeirah and the newer harbour frontage connect. The smart approach is practical. Confirm the exact boarding point before leaving your hotel. Access within Dubai Harbour can be confusing, especially when operators mention different gates or marina entry points. It is also wise to allow extra transfer time, as road traffic can shift quickly. Light matters here. Late afternoon often gives softer views and a more comfortable temperature. In cooler months, an outdoor deck is usually the better choice. In hotter or windier conditions, a shorter cruise or a land-based walk around Dubai Marina can be the better alternative.

Frequently asked questions

What is so special about Dubai Marina?
Dubai Marina is known for its dense waterfront skyline, yacht-lined channels and walkable promenade. From Dubai Harbour - Bay Marina, the appeal becomes easier to read. A boat tour shows how the marina fits into a wider coastal setting, between Palm Jumeirah and the newer harbour district.
What is the best time to go to Dubai Marina and Dubai Harbour?
The best time depends on heat, light and wind. Late afternoon is often more comfortable and gives softer views of the skyline. In hotter months, avoid the most exposed part of the day. For clearer photos and a smoother ride, calm weather matters more than any exact hour.
How far is Dubai cruise port from Dubai Marina?
It depends on which port you mean. Dubai Harbour sits close to Dubai Marina, while the main large-cruise terminal is in a different part of the city. For practical planning, check the exact departure point on your booking details. Driving time can vary significantly with traffic and time of day.
Where do cruise ships dock in Dubai?
Large cruise ships usually use a dedicated cruise terminal rather than a leisure marina. Dubai Harbour - Bay Marina is better understood as a yachting and excursion setting, not a standard ocean-cruise terminal. Always confirm whether your departure is a sightseeing cruise, a private boat trip or a major cruise embarkation.
How much time should I allow for a visit here?
Allow for more than just the time on the water. You may need transfer time, a check-in window and some waiting before boarding. The total duration depends on the operator and route. In practice, a light half-day plan is the safest option if you want a relaxed experience.
Is Dubai Harbour - Bay Marina suitable for families?
Yes, provided children are comfortable with heat, waiting time and boat movement. The experience is easy to follow because the views are immediate and visual. For a smoother outing, choose a manageable duration, carry water and confirm stroller access or boarding conditions in advance if needed.
Can I combine this with a walk around Dubai Marina?
Yes, and it makes sense. The boat tour gives you the broad coastal picture, while a walk in Dubai Marina adds street-level detail. Together, they offer two useful perspectives on the same area. This is a good plan if you want both skyline views and a more grounded feel.
